FORD EXPLORER 2012 5.G Owners Manual Night time and dark area use
At night time or in dark areas, the camera system relies on the reverse
lamp lighting to produce an image. Therefore, it is necessary that both
reverse lamps are operating

FORD EXPLORER 2012 5.G Owners Manual Activating/deactivating collision warning system
To turn the warning system and/or chime on or off and set the warning
sensitivity <– –>, refer toMessage centerin theInstrument Cluster
chapter.
